ThroBak Unveils Vintage Choice Balanced Medium Acoustic Guitar Strings

Geared for players who want a more balanced feel and a popular choice for DADGAD or standard tuning.

Grand Rapids, MI (October 19, 2015) -- Introducing new ThroBak Vintage Choice Balanced Medium Acoustic Guitar strings for players who want a more balanced feel and a popular choice for DADGAD or standard tuning. Available in Round and Hex Core configurations.

ThroBak Vintage Choice round core acoustic strings are wound with 92/8 Phosphor Bronze. The round core gives a distinctive warm, full sound that any fan of round wound acoustic strings will immediately recognize. The added low end sweetness the round core adds makes these a popular choice for strummers and pickers. FlatLock technology ensures that all round core strings maintain tight, uniform winds. Increasingly rare, ThroBak is proud to be one of just a few companies still offering acoustic round core strings.

ThroBak Vintage Choice hex core acoustic strings have an added treble presence to the wound strings that make them the go to string for most acoustic players. Wound with the highest quality 92/8 Phosphor Bronze assuring the best possible tone and longevity. Made in U.S.A. using only the finest U.S.A. wire.

ThroBak Vintage Choice strings are custom made by a small two man machine shop with a 45+ year history of making precision string winding machines and custom guitar strings. Enjoy the longevity and tuning stability from a premium guitar string with ThroBak guitar strings.

Pricing information: $9.25 (set), $24.98 (3-pack) and $44.40 (6-pack)
